8' CMMG MK4 PDW 8' 300blk upper. Meat and potatoes dmps lower with mill spec trigger. Blade brace, phase five buffer tube (I like it better than the kak notch tube). Cheapie x6 scope that will be swapped out for a x4 scope. Without the scope it's just over 5lbs. Slowly making it lighter. Adding titanium parts. When The 7' KMR comes out I will swap rails. The goal is a light reliable CQB-250yard hearing safe hiking gun. R
